Probably my favouritest place to dine at in KSL, the soup here is really, really flavourful. I managed to finish the whole pot by myself! 😬 The soup is boiled in an urn under constant charcoal fire for hours on end and is fetched by staff from deep within the urn when one is ordered. It is filled with herbs and meat, definitely value for money!

I like that the noodles here goes really well with the gravy at the bottom. The siu yok is a little too fatty for my liking but decent nonetheless. The XO roast duck however, is flavourful and retains the correct balance of meat and fat. A really good place to eat at if you crave soup and a good bowl of noodles ◡̈

I was never a fan of chendol but the ones here took my breath away, especially the original Baba Cendol. A mountain of ice sitting on a bed of ingredients topped with a generous serving of Gula Melaka is a definite welcome in the tropical heat. The durian one was equally good although it will get a little cloying towards the end. Give the sago one a miss though, you won't be losing out.

Probably my favouritest meal in Malacca. The laksa at Jonker 88 is brimming with ingredients! The Nyonya Laksa is probably the most enjoyable as it is more sour than spicy (think Assam laksa) which makes the broth extremely addictive. The Baba Laksa is more like Singapore's version although very heavy with coconut cream, which can get too cloying after a while. The third variant, which is a mixture of the two, somehow turns out to be fiery spicy which makes it difficult to enjoy the otherwise extremely tasty broth. The noodles they used reminds me of Mee Yai Mak, interesting indeed. Rojak was equally enjoyable too and the Fu Pei had a hidden surprise within its crispness ◡̈
